I used to use Ulead dvd workshop 2, before upgrading to windows 7. I just started using DVDit Pro 6 and I'm having a bit of a problem that I hope you all can help with.
I have 6 movie files and 3 menus and I'm having troubles mapping the menu and title buttons.
The 1st movie is a force-play, that I don't want any action, when I press either button. I selected no action from the dvd remote section in the Project window for both buttons.
Menu 1 is a branching menu, which takes you to the features and extras menus. No problem there.
For movies 2,3&6, I want the menu & title buttons to take you to Menu 2 & for movies 4&5, I want the menu & title buttons to take you to menu 3.
I've got to each movie and I selected the MENU 2 selection for movies 2,3&6 and the MENU 3 selection for 4&5 from the appropriate remote sections in the Project window.
When I ran the simulation, everything worked fine.
When I created an .iso file each movie took me back to either menu 1 or the intro movie, depending on which button placed.
What did I do wrong?
